Bug description:
  Binary package hint: samba

  after launching update-manager, samba-common failed with statuscode 1
  --all further dependencies failed to install.

  apt-get update && apt-get upgrade showed the same behaviour.

  the file /etc/samba/smb.conf had been moved (by me, during some tests)
  to /etc/samba/smb.conf.backup.

  After restoring the smb.conf file to its original name, apt-get
  upgrade was able to upgrade samba-common and all of its dependencies.
